use crate::{Checker, Diagnostic, Edit, Fix, FixAvailability, Rule, Violation};
pub struct CommandSubstitutionInAlias;
impl Violation for CommandSubstitutionInAlias {
const FIX_AVAILABILITY: FixAvailability = FixAvailability::Sometimes;
fn rule() -> Rule {
Rule::CommandSubstitutionInAlias
}
fn message(&self) -> String {
"avoid expansions in alias definitions".to_owned()
}
fn fix_title(&self) -> Option<String> {
Some("single-quote the alias definition".to_owned())
}
}
pub fn command_substitution_in_alias(checker: &mut Checker) {
checker.report_fact_diagnostics_dedup(|facts, report| {
for fact in facts.command_facts().alias_definition_expansion_facts() {
let diagnostic = Diagnostic::new(CommandSubstitutionInAlias, fact.span());
let diagnostic = match fact.replacement() {
Some((span, replacement)) => {
diagnostic.with_fix(Fix::unsafe_edit(Edit::replacement(replacement, span)))
}
None => diagnostic,
};
report(diagnostic);
}
});
}
